Present patterns Given that the advent of Web telephone systems (Voice over IP) innovations, PBX development has actually tended towards the IP PBX, which uses the Web Protocol to bring calls.
RBS (robbed bit signaling) delivers 24 digital circuits over a four-wire (T1) interface basic POTS (plain old telephone service) lines the common two-wire user interface used in a lot of domestic homes. This is sufficient only for smaller sized systems, and can experience not being able to identify inbound calls when trying to make an outbound call (commonly called glare).

Normally the service is supplied by a lease agreement and the company can, in some configurations, utilize the very same changing equipment to service numerous hosted PBX clients. The first hosted PBX services were feature-rich compared to the majority of premises-based systems of the time. Some PBX functions, such as follow-me calling, appeared in a hosted service prior to they ended up being available in hardware PBX devices.
This permits one extension to ring in numerous locations (either simultaneously or sequentially) (Voice Over Ip Business Phone System). enables scalability so that a larger system is not needed if brand-new staff members are worked with, and so that resources are not lost if the number of staff members is reduced. gets rid of the need for business to manage or spend for on-site hardware upkeep.
Mobile PBX systems are various from other hosted PBX systems that just forward data or contacts us to mobile phones by permitting the mobile phone itself, through using buttons, secrets and other input gadgets, to control PBX phone functions and to manage communications without having to call into the system initially.

To work out what's best for you, you ought to look for the phone system that can best cater to your small company' particular needs. Working out what those requirements really are is as basic as asking yourself a handful of questions: Is your team office-based, remote, or a mix of both? Would you like your team to deal with dedicated desk phones, or will an app on their mobile phones or computer systems suffice? What does your phone system need to be able to do to assist your group interact effectively and expertly with customers or clients? What are the methods your group prefers to utilize to communicate and collaborate with one another? Do you have a sales or contact/call center team that would gain from more sophisticated functions, like call monitoring and analytics? What's your spending plan?
